Marines are labelled as 'prey' and certainly I found the Marine hard to play as you feel vulnerable all the time - the guns aren't amazingly powerful.

This worries me a bit - I thought the balance was

Aliens - move fast and hit hard upclose but are fragile

Predator - move in stealth and hit hard from afar but fragile up-close

Marines - lethal against anything they can see/target

Loving the Predator cloaking because it's not QUITE perfect - e.g. you can see a Predator moving pretty much as you could in the films - as a Predator discovered earlier trying to sneak upto me from in-front (I waited until he was close and then let rip with the Shotgun :hat: )

it caused no end of frustration when it was utterly invisible - although it did have one absolutely beautiful side effect which is that your brain acknowledged that the grass in front of you was moving but by the time you realised it wasn't just an animation and it was heading your way, you were dead

nice compromise I think - his cloak shimmers only when he moves, otherwise he's a ghost

Linkster, is defending against an Alien tail attack just a case of getting in there with a light attack before their animation ends? It's proving a tad tricky to pull off.

yep, light interrupts heavy (since latter is designed to break block)

Also, something that doesn't come across in the tutorial video posted earlier - when blocking in order to execute a counter, do you have to activate block during the enemy's wind up or can you put your Dukes up first?

the latter. it's the bounce off the block that causes the flinch and allows you to counter, not block interrupting the attack
